Fed Cup: Kwara Utd plot Rangers exit
Maigidansanma said in Ilorin on Tuesday that the team's recent resurgence is a big boost going into the match on Thursday at the Area 3 pitch in Abuja.
"I have always believed in these boys and I am sure they will not disappoint on Thursday
"We are going into the game with our highest belief this season because we have been able to win back to back in the league" Maigidansanma said.
Also reacting to the match, one of the most experienced players in the team, Dare Ojo said there won't be a place for Rangers to hide on Thursday in Abuja.
"We are very confident going into this game.
"We want to play in the continent next season and this is one of the few opportunities available to do so.
"We want to take a step forward in our season starting from Thursday" Ojo said.
Another player in his reaction, Halilu Obadaki maintained that the team is gathering momentum need to finish the season well.
The powerful playing left full back added that they want to surpass the quarter finals reached in the 2010 edition of the competition.
"We will continue our recent good form on Thursday in Abuja by beating Rangers.
"We did it in the league, beating them 3-1 in Ilorin during the course of the season this year, so we will do it again on Thursday in Abuja" Obadaki said.
One of the goal scorers in the match day 19 Nigeria Professional Football League in Ilorin on Sunday against Giwa FC, Abubakar Yusuf, said the spirit in the team is high and that the attitude will help them on Thursday in Abuja when they lock horns with Rangers.
"We are very determined these days, many of us can't believe where the spirit in camp is coming from.
"We have been bringing down the so called big teams recently which I believe Rangers is one of them.
"Rangers will surely fall on Thursday I can assure you" Yusuf said.
It would be recalled that Kwara United defeated a non league side, A.B.U Zaria, 5-3 on penalties after 2-2 scoreline during normal time in Minna, Niger State in the round of 32.
They had earlier defeated also Akwa Starlets in the round of 64 after emerging the state champions in the play off.
